YV03 XBG is a 2003 Land Rover Range Rover in Blue with a 4,398cc petrol engine. This vehicle has been through 26 MOT tests with a personal pass rate of 76.9%.
Across all 2003 Land Rover Range Rover models, the average MOT pass rate is 76.0% with a typical mileage of 99,099 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Land Rover Range Rover fails its MOT is brake pipe excessively corroded, accounting for 63,439 recorded failures. If you're considering buying YV03 XBG, it's worth having these areas checked by a mechanic before committing.
The Land Rover Range Rover typically stays on UK roads for around 39 years. At 23 years old, this Land Rover Range Rover is well into its expected lifespan but still has years ahead.
